Quantum statistical approach to the equation of state and the critical point of cesium plasma
R. Redmer and
G. Röpke
Physica A: Statistical Mechanics and its Applications, 1985, vol. 130, issue 3, 523-552
Abstract:
The equation of state of a partially ionized plasma is derived within the frame of thermodynamic Green functions. Evaluating the self-energy in a cluster expansion, the formation of bound states is treated in a systematic way. The account of bound states (atoms, dimers) leads to an essential lowering of the critical temperature compared with previous approaches, where the interaction of bound states with free charge carriers via the polarization potential was neglected. Thus, a better agreement with the experimental data is achieved.
